Butterflai is an AI business intelligence platform for small and medium-sized companies. Connect the systems you already run, ERP, e-commerce, marketing, and analytics tools like Softone, Shopify, WooCommerce, Google Ads, and Meta; and ask questions about your business in plain language. Answers are computed from your data and source-referenced, not guessed. Butterflai also builds KPI dashboards automatically and generates reports like Executive Reports and eCommerce Core KPIs. Available on web, iOS, and Android in 8 languages. Your business data is stored and processed in the EU.

A genuinely useful AI platform for company knowledge

We’ve been using Butterflai for a while now, and it’s one of the few AI tools that has actually made it easier to find information instead of adding another layer of complexity.

What I like most is being able to search across different knowledge sources from a single place. Whether the information is in documents, internal knowledge bases or business systems, asking a question is often much faster than trying to remember where the information is.

The Custom Dashboards are a great addition, making it easy for non-technical users to explore business data without building reports. The interface is clean, responses are fast, and it’s clear the platform is designed for enterprise use rather than being just another generic AI chatbot.

One feature I’d love to see is cross-platform dashboard widgets. For example, having a single widget that combines the performance of the same campaign across Facebook, Instagram and TikTok Ads instead of viewing each widget separately.
Being able to see total spend, impressions, clicks, conversions and ROAS in one place would make executive dashboards even more valuable.

Overall, a very promising platform with practical use cases and a team that seems focused on building features that solve real business problems. Looking forward to seeing how it continues to evolve.
